The average bus between Madrid and Bordeaux takes 9h 45m and the fastest bus takes 8h 25m. The bus service runs several times per day from Madrid to Bordeaux.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run 4 times a day between Madrid and Bordeaux. The earliest departure is at 5:20 PM in the evening, and the last departure from Madrid is at 9:35 PM which arrives into Bordeaux at 7:55 AM. All services run direct with no transfers required, and take on average 9h 45m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Madrid station and arriving at Bordeaux station. Services depart 4 times a day, and operate Twice daily. The journey takes approximately 9h 45m.
Madrid to Bordeaux b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Madrid - Barajas Airport T4 station.
Madrid to Bordeaux b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Bordeaux - Belcier Bus Stop station.

The distance between Madrid and Bordeaux is 554.2 km. The road distance is 684 km.
B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Madrid - Barajas Airport T4 to Bordeaux - Belcier Bus Stop twice daily. Tickets cost €60–110 and the journey takes 8h 10m. ALSA also services this route once daily.
